Ski Ober Gatlinburg!

Winter weather has finally arrived in Gatlinburg and snowmaking is in full force at Ober Gatlinburg. Skiing, snowboarding and snow tubing are available and colder temperatures make snow making possible when the temperature dips below 32 degrees. Ober began the season on January 3 with Castle Run, Cub Way and the Ski School slopes in operating and is opening additional slopes as conditions improve. Snow tubing is open dialing with sessions beginning at 11a.m.

Ober Gatlinburg features nine trails serviced by two quad lifts, one double lift and one surface lift.  The Resort offers terrain for all abilities, from a beginner experiencing the joy of snow sports for the first time, to a seasoned expert hitting the moguls and terrain park.  The resort also has a popular snow tubing park, skiing and snowboarding equipment rental, an ice skating rink, aerial tramway, alpine slide, restaurants, shops and more.
